MSCE Pune Scholarship 2020- An Overview

MSCE Pune Scholarship is a scheme of Maharashtra State Council for Examination (MSCE), Pune to award financial assistance and empowering the students coming from backward communities of the society. These basically include scheduled tribe, scheduled caste, various other minority and nomadic tribes of the state of Maharashtra.

Under this scheme, council award two type of scholarships viz.-

  • Pre Upper Primary Scholarship Examination (PUP)- Class 5th
  • Pre Secondary Scholarship Examination (PSP)- Class 8th

Eligibility  

Before the applying for scholarship, students/ parents should read the eligibility requirements first. They can check the eligibility details here-

Nativity Criteria

  • Students applying for this scholarship test should be domiciled in Maharashtra and should possess a valid domicile certificate.

Educational Qualification

  • Applicants/ Students must be studying in a government school, aided school, unaided school, granted or non-granted school in the respective classes. 

Age Criteria



  • The age limit for class 5th i.e. PUP is 11 years and for physically disabled is 15 years.
  • The age limit for class 8th i.e. PSS is 14 years and physically disabled students it is 18 years.

Other Criteria

  • The annual income of father of students who claims to comes from Tribal or any other backward community in the application form should not exceed Rs. 20000/-.

Application fee

All the candidates are required to pay an application of Rs.20/-. Candidates also have to make payment of examination fee. However, the students from minority community are exempted from payment of examination fee. Students coming from CBSE and ICSE board are required to pay the exam fee.

If a candidate fails to submit applications on or before the due date, they have to submit the late fee.

Examination Pattern

  • Class 5th (PUP)
  • Mode of examination- Offline
  • Type of questions- Objective type
  • No. of paper- Two
  • Total no. of questions- 75 each paper
  • Total marks- 150 each paper
  • Duration of exam- 1 hour 30 minutes each paper
  • Medium of exam- Marathi/ Hindi/ English/ Gujarati/ Telugu/ Kannada/ Urdu

Difficulty level-

  • Easy- 30% questions
  • Medium- 40% questions 
  • Hard- 30% questions

Class 8th (PSS)

The exam pattern is same as of class 5th but syllabus will be different. Questions in class 5th paper will be mainly based on class 4th syllabus and in case of PSS it will be based on class 7th syllabus.

Scholarship Amount

After the announcement of result, students selected for the award of the scholarship will receive scholarship amount. Selected students are paid Rs.100 to 500 per month.
